Mentally retarded and nonretarded adults' memory for spatial location
Abstract:
The claim that memory for spatial location is automatic was evaluated. Mentally retarded and nonretarded adults studied 16 objects on a matrix in front of them under one of two instructional conditions: intentional or incidental. They then tried to recall both the objects and their locations. Results showed that memory for spatial location was above chance under both instructional conditions. Intention to encode spatial location had no effect on recall. Finally, retarded and nonretarded adults differed in recall of the objects but not in recall of spatial locations. The findings support several of the criteria for automaticity proposed by Hasher and Zacks (1979) and suggest that automatic encoding of spatial location is an area of strength for retarded persons.

Long-Term Memory
Long-term memory can be categorized into two primary types: explicit and implicit memory. Explicit memory, also known as declarative memory, involves the conscious recollection of information that we deliberately try to remember, recall, and articulate. Amnesia
The severity and duration of memory loss vary depending on the type and underlying cause. Amnesia is classified into two main types: retrograde and anterograde.
Retrograde amnesia is marked by the loss of memories formed before the onset of the condition. Patients may recall distant past events but often forget those occurring shortly before the incident.
